探索React Native的新选择:Context Menu View
React Native作为一个跨平台移动应用开发框架,已经成为了许多开发者的心头好。今天,我们要向大家推荐一个特别的React Native组件:。它提供了一种优雅的方式来展示上下文菜单,让您的应用程序界面更加丰富且互动性更强。
项目简介
react-native-context-menu-view是由开发者创建的一个开源库。它的主要目标是为React Native应用添加可自定义的、交互式的上下文菜单。这个菜单可以以浮动视图的形式出现在屏幕上的任何位置,使得用户在不离开当前页面的情况下,能够轻松访问或执行额外的操作。
技术分析
使用React Native
项目基于React Native构建,这意味着它可以无缝地运行在iOS和Android平台上,无需重新编写代码。通过React的声明式编程风格,开发人员可以很容易地理解和控制菜单的显示逻辑。
自定义化
组件允许开发者通过props高度定制菜单的外观和行为。你可以设置菜单项的文字、图标、颜色,甚至菜单的弹出动画。这种灵活性让设计师可以根据品牌需求来打造独一无二的用户体验。
响应式设计
菜单会根据设备的方向(横屏或竖屏)和可用空间自动调整布局。同时,它支持触摸事件,确保在不同设备上都能顺畅地与菜单进行交互。
轻松集成
react-native-context-menu-view遵循npm包的标准安装流程,只需一行命令即可将其添加到你的项目中。其文档清晰详尽,提供快速开始和示例代码,帮助开发者迅速理解并实现功能。
应用场景
- 在图片查看器应用中,为图片提供编辑、分享等选项。
- 在列表视图中,右键点击某个项目时出现相关操作菜单。
- 在地图应用中,长按某地点以显示周边信息或导航选项。
- 在文本编辑器中,为选中的文字提供复制、剪切、粘贴等功能。
特点概览
- 跨平台兼容:适用于iOS和Android。
- 高度自定义:样式、动画、菜单项均可定制。
- 响应式:自动适应屏幕方向和尺寸变化。
- 易于集成:简单的API和丰富的文档支持。
- 流畅交互:支持触控反馈,提升用户体验。
结论
react-native-context-menu-view是一个强大的工具,将为你的React Native应用增添新的功能和视觉吸引力。无论你是要增强现有项目的交互性,还是正在寻找一个起点来启动你的新项目,这个库都值得考虑。立即尝试,并让你的应用脱颖而出吧!
本文完,希望您发现react-native-context-menu-view的价值,并在您的项目中发挥它的潜力!如需进一步了解或获取支持,请访问项目GitHub仓库。祝您编码愉快!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



